php框架性能测试为什么是最好的PHP框架,为什么要使用的模板引擎框架php框架性能排行榜
2023-01-18
是当今最熟练、流行和广泛使用的开源框架之一。 它具有多种功能,如模板引擎、MVC架构支持、高安全性、开发者工具、数据库迁移等,这些高级特性使其优于其他PHP框架。
它为高端 Web 应用程序开发提供基准测试和功能丰富的解决方案。 该框架已完全实施,并提供了有效使用它所需的最佳实践。
为什么要使用它?
是精准的PHP框架,可以无缝满足各种规模的开源应用开发需求,也是开发者的理想之选。 其庞大的社区支持为编程问题提供了快速解决方案。 此外,它还提供了一个学习论坛。
为什么它是最好的 PHP 框架?
由于其优秀和丰富的特性,它已经成为最好的PHP框架。 例如,腾云网络的开发可以通过高级功能创建具有吸引力和高性能的网络应用程序。 他们可以用最少的重复编码任务来做到这一点。
框架的主要功能是什么?
1.创新的模板引擎
该框架因其内置的轻量级模板而广受认可,这些模板可用于构建具有动态内容的布局。 它还提供了一些基本的小部件,这些小部件使用其结构来集成 CSS 和 JS 代码。 模板经过精心设计,可以开发简单明了的布局以及部件的组合布局,从而简化开发人员的工作。
2.通过内置函数支持MVC架构
支持MVC架构模式,保证重要业务逻辑与表现层分离。 MVC 模式有几个内置功能,可以提高应用程序性能并提高安全性和可伸缩性。
3、编码授权技术
当我们生成用于构建应用程序的代码时,授权和身份验证部分是最重要的功能。 它还评估程序员构建新内容所花费的时间。 该框架甚至具有有助于改革授权逻辑和控制对不同资源的访问的逻辑技术。
由于集成了验证计算机代码,有效减少了编码时间。 它的应用程序推理功能为编码人员提供了灵活性和自由度,可以灵活地处理各种规模的软件。
4. 对象关系映射与实现
提供对象关系映射(ORM),结合简单的PHP实现。 此功能有助于使 Web 应用程序开发人员能够使用 PHP 语法而不是编写 SQL 代码来编写数据库查询。 而且 ORM 比以前的 PHP 框架更快。
5.强大的应用程序安全性
安全性是最好的功能之一。 该框架提供了先进而强大的 Web 应用程序安全性php框架性能测试,让开发人员可以放心使用。 该安全功能有效地利用了密码的盐散列和加密,因此它不会以明文形式将密码保存到用户数据库中。
它还使用“散列算法”来创建加密密码。 此外,此 PHP Web 开发框架利用 SQL 语句来防止 SQL 注入。
6. 自动化编程任务的工具
该框架提供了一个内置的命令行工具,可以帮助我们自动化繁琐和重复的编程任务。 该工具还用于构建数据库结构和框架代码。 进一步用于处理迁移库,因此管理各种数据库非常方便。
此外,它可以通过命令行生成原始 MVC 文件php框架性能测试,并使用其配置处理这些文件。 甚至协助开发人员生成命令并根据需要使用它们。
7.启用库和模块化功能
预安装的面向对象和模块化库为开发人员提供了便利网站模板,其中一些在其他 PHP 框架中无法访问,但在 PHP 中运行良好。 例如,实现一个认证库非常简单,它还可以有多种功能。
这些功能包括检查活动用户、密码重置、散列、CSRF(跨站点请求伪造)保护和加密。 此外,该框架被划分为采用高级 PHP 原则的独立单元,支持响应式和模块化 Web 应用程序开发。
8. 通过PHP代码简化数据库迁移系统
迁移功能有助于扩展 Web 应用程序数据库结构,这样就不需要在每次更改代码时都重新创建它。 此功能大大降低了丢失数据所涉及的风险。
该函数不仅提供了改变数据库整体结构的功能,还提供了一些额外的功能。 它甚至可以更好地帮助利用 PHP 代码进行利用。 此外,还可以帮助开发人员在指定时间生成数据库表并插入包含所需列的索引。
9. 有竞争力且简单的单元测试
是 Web 应用程序开发人员的理想框架,因为它可以高效、轻松地促进单元测试功能。 该框架在运行大量单元测试方面做得很好,以避免程序员在不更改现有 Web 应用程序的情况下进行新更改。 理想情况下,基于 Web 的应用程序可以稳定发布,因为它可以识别故障并发出警告。 编写单元测试对开发人员来说也毫不费力。
10.有用的教程
为初学者和有经验的开发人员提供方便的学习资源。 无论您浏览免费视频教程还是付费服务,您都可以学习如何使用它。 提供的学习说明是最新的且易于理解,使学习该技术框架变得容易。
框架对开发人员的优势 框架可以让您无后顾之忧地进行身份验证。 一切都经过适当配置,具有组织良好的授权逻辑和所需的对各种资源的受控访问。 该框架通过库提供了一个干净、易于使用的 API。 还提供驱动程序,允许应用程序快速启动,通过本地或支持云的服务发送邮件或通知。 支持流行的缓存后端,因此开发人员可以快速配置缓存。 集成高级日志库对开发者非常有帮助,它为一系列强大的日志处理程序提供了技术支持。 每个路由都定义在 app/Http/.php 文件中网站建设,由框架自动加载。 它还提供了一种强大的方式来通过接受 URL 和闭包来识别路由方法。要点
上述特性使其在整个开发者社区中发挥着良好的作用,并且对某些人来说可能非常有用。 它通过其经典架构继续在开发人员中吸引新的采用者。 该架构已成为不同开发人员为各种项目创建自己的功能集的开放场所。